Shelter
ˈʃɛltə
- a place giving temporary protection from bad weather or danger
"huts like this are used as a shelter during the winter"
- a place providing food and accommodation for the homeless
"did they give you any breakfast at the shelter?"
- an animal sanctuary
"the shelter sees many dogs which have been dumped on Dartmoor"
- a shielded or safe condition; protection
"he hung back in the shelter of a rock"
- protect or shield from something harmful, especially bad weather
"the hut sheltered him from the cold wind"
